Istanbul, April 16 – A horrific murder occurred in Istanbul’s Kartal district, where 59-year-old Ruhan Çalu was found stabbed to death in her home. Police have arrested a 20-year-old suspect, M.D.G., in Kocaeli.
Details of the Incident
According to reports, neighbors in the Esentepe neighborhood of Kartal heard sounds coming from Ruhan Çalu’s apartment in the morning and reported it to the police. Police and medical teams were dispatched to the scene. Upon entering the apartment, which had an open door, teams found Ruhan Çalu in a pool of blood.
Medical examinations confirmed that Çalu, who had been stabbed in various parts of her body, had succumbed to her injuries. After crime scene investigation teams completed their work, Çalu’s body was transferred to the Forensic Medicine Institute morgue.
Investigation and Suspect Apprehension
Homicide detectives conducted searches in nearby garbage containers as part of their investigation. As a result of the police’s efforts, M.D.G. (20) was identified as the suspect in Ruhan Çalu’s murder.
Investigations revealed that the suspect left the house after committing the murder and fled the scene in a taxi. M.D.G. was subsequently apprehended in Kocaeli, where he had fled, and taken into custody.
Ongoing Work
The police’s work regarding the incident is ongoing. This incident adds to the tragic number of femicides in Turkey.
